Proverbs 27:19 Commentary

The experience of looking into the face of another provides a reflection of our own internal state that is as accurate and as revealing as the image of a face in the water. When an individual handles their motivations with a focus on the truth, they find that their commitment to the light provides a source of healing for their own soul and a source of safety for their neighbor's household. As in water (ma-yim) face reflects (hap-pa-nim) face, so the heart (leb) of man reflects the man. Jesus Christ taught that what comes out of a person is what defiles them, for from within, out of the heart of man, come evil thoughts and every kind of spiritual failure (Matthew 15:18-20). He understood that the hallmark of a sincere faith was its commitment to a life of quiet and durable righteousness in every social interaction. Jesus Christ Himself portrayed a path of perfect purity of heart throughout his mission, always revealing the heart of the Father and providing the definitive standard for all human character.
